Output 881f96a65d936d173c60cdec7731c9ca6de7d2bf97da674efdaae74a3f017410:29

value
309898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4fbfbc8827739bef007678f2fc89be4c419be74 OP_EQUAL
address
3NZmrQMsXfoQSD8m9WYTWia54Q97f2bECs
transaction
881f96a65d936d173c60cdec7731c9ca6de7d2bf97da674efdaae74a3f017410
spent
true